Output 3eb7518b539957f49fa86ee601545dd4d77936148b15d4f52e9612cef5e2b201:0

value
1010325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6a102c59a7686fda62e13b49bb1c2b4361ddb58 OP_EQUAL
address
3NiUDtkvTKyxjyappXcDSzh1QyhYS8tEMu
transaction
3eb7518b539957f49fa86ee601545dd4d77936148b15d4f52e9612cef5e2b201
confirmations
378563
spent
true